1 微服務 1.1 思想 開發人員自己測試、部署和運維自己編寫的代碼,即自己負責構建生命周期的全部。 1.2 Spring Boot 提供服務化的能力,即把容器、服務所需依賴和服務一起打包成一個jar包,直接運行jar便部署了一個服務。 Spring Boot可以把Spring的一切都 ...
容器化和虛擬化 容器:運行在更為完全隔離的沙盒中,出現在每個容器里的僅僅是操作系統的最小內核,共享了底層系統的資源。容器化的最大優勢在於對於相同的硬件占用空間更小,可以比虛擬機運行更多的實例。 虛擬機:運行的是一個完整的組件堆棧 從操作系統到應用服務器,以及仿真的虛擬硬件包括網絡組件 CPU和內存。 微服務 每一個服務完全獨立 不用關心各自用什么語言,什么平台 單個服務單個遷移 跨服務之間不能共 ...
2016-07-01 15:00 0 3031 推薦指數:
1 微服務 1.1 思想 開發人員自己測試、部署和運維自己編寫的代碼,即自己負責構建生命周期的全部。 1.2 Spring Boot 提供服務化的能力,即把容器、服務所需依賴和服務一起打包成一個jar包,直接運行jar便部署了一個服務。 Spring Boot可以把Spring的一切都 ...
專欄前面的文章,我主要給你講解了微服務架構的基礎組成以及在具體落地實踐過程中的會遇到的問題和解決方案,這些是掌握微服務架構最基礎的知識。從今天開始,我們將進一步深入微服務架構進階的內容,也就是微服務與容器、DevOps之間的關系。它們三個雖然分屬於不同領域,但卻有着千絲萬縷的關系,可以說沒有容器 ...
原文鏈接:微服務化之無狀態化與容器化(來源:劉超的通俗雲計算) 一、為什么要做無狀態化和容器化 很多應用拆分成微服務,是為了承載高並發,往往一個進程扛不住這么大的量,因而需要拆分成多組進程,每組進程承載特定的工作,根據並發的壓力用多個副本公共承擔流量。將一個進程變成多組進程,每組進程多個 ...
本文由 網易雲 發布。 作者:馮常健 摘要:網易雲容器平台期望能給實施了微服務架構的團隊提供完整的解決方案和閉環的用戶體驗,為此從 2016 年開始,我們容器服務團隊內部率先開始進行 dogfooding 實踐,看看容器雲平台能不能支撐得起容器服務本身的微服務架構,這是一次 ...
.NET 微服務:適用於容器化 .NET 應用的體系結構 容器和 Docker 簡介 什么是 Docker? Docker 術語 Docker 容器、映像和注冊表 為 Docker 容器選擇 .NET Core 還是 .NET Framework 通用指南 何時為 Docker 容器 ...
現在一聊到容器技術,大家就默認是指 Docker 了。但事實上,在 Docker 出現之前,PaaS社區早就有容器技術了,以 Cloud Foundry、OpenShift 為代表的就是當時的主流。 那為啥最終還是 Docker 火起來了呢? 因為傳統的PaaS技術雖然也可以一鍵將本地 ...
技術交流群:233513714 六大優勢 微服務架構相對於傳統的SOA,優勢也很明顯: 1、復雜度可控:在將應用分解的同時,規避了原本復雜度無止境的積累。每一個微服務專注於單一功能,並通過定義良好的接口清晰表述服務邊界。由於體積小、復雜度低,每個微服務可由一個小規模開發團隊完全掌控 ...
微服務化 很多傳統企業看着互聯網公司都進行着微服務化,因此也想享受微服務化帶來的好處便對自己的系統進行改造,但微服務化 多“微”才是最優?有哪些拆分的原則? 架構原則 使用成熟的技術,不需要最先進最好的技術,要是自己人能夠掌控的,不然出現莫名的問題,一兩天都可能解 ...